How to:
This fence you see here has been handmade by me. I first printed a pic of fence on a white cardstock. cut it with my Fiskars knife. Then I applied some Versamark ink straight from the refill. I applied the heat embossing powder in cream and heat embossed . I repeated the embossing again and again till I was satisfied. This process gave it a lot of thickness exactly what I wanted. Once cooled, I applied some alcohol ink on it in ginger and latter colour and finally layers of gesso on top. this process was really tiresome but it comes in handy if you don't have what you need right at the moment. it did cause a little warping in my cut out so I adhered the fence with some cardboard on the back. since it did not show it wasn't important to be precise with the cutting ;)
